Position Summary
The Director of Program Management is responsible for leading the project management function across Race Rock’s Engineered Structures Division, ensuring consistent execution of customer projects from order release through delivery. This role oversees the Project Management team and establishes the processes, systems, KPIs, and communication standards required to support scalable, high-performance execution across the organization.
This position serves as the operational bridge between customer commitments and internal execution, aligning priorities across operations, engineering, sourcing, scheduling, logistics, and leadership teams. The Director of Program Management is responsible for driving visibility, accountability, and proactive communication throughout the project lifecycle while ensuring customer requirements, timelines, and operational capabilities remain aligned.
The Director of Program Management also leads continuous improvement initiatives for the PM (Project Management) function, including development of standard operating procedures, reporting tools, escalation processes, and workflow optimization. This role plays a key leadership position in supporting growth and operational standardization across Race Rock facilities.
Success in this role requires strong leadership, operational understanding, customer focus, process discipline, and the ability to influence cross-functional teams in a fast-paced engineer-to-order manufacturing environment.

What makes a director of program management role senior level?
Senior level roles are defined by program scope, decision-making authority, and leadership expectations. Rather than executing within a defined structure, senior directors build and own that structure, set priorities across workstreams, and are accountable for program-level outcomes. They are also expected to develop other program managers, shape team processes, and engage directly with senior leadership and executive sponsors.
